titleOfInvention |
Tire rubber composition |
abstract |
Provided is a tire rubber composition blended with an antioxidant that is derived from a raw material other than petroleum resources, the tire rubber composition being capable of achieving an oxidation resistance equal to or higher than a conventional level and of improving forming processability and a low hysteresis loss property. The tire rubber composition includes a blend of: 100 parts by weight of a diene rubber; 5 to 130 parts by weight of an inorganic filler; and 0.01 to 10 parts by weight of a tea extract containing a catechin. |
